For Only Watch 2011, Bell & Ross has created the BR01 Casino. The dial is made up of three rotating concentric circles in pink gold. And yes, it does tell the time. Have you worked out how? We’ll tell you inside. The 46mm diameter case is pink gold and PVD, and the roulette-themed display is powered by an automatic ETA 2892-based movement. So what time is it? 10:10 of course.
